Sri Lanka’s ‘FH Studio Collection’ has clinched markets in the Czech Republic following its success at the recent “Colombo Fashion Week 2010”.

 

The “FH Studio Collection”, the most exclusive and innovative designer collection by Sri Lanka’s renowned  men’s wear specialist Fouzul Hameed was showcased on opening night on the catwalks at the Colombo Fashion Week 2010. Among the collections were the ‘Summer Wear Collection’ and the ‘Ceremonial Wear Collection’, both of which were presented by leading Sri Lankan and foreign models.

 

Audience appreciation was at its highest level to what was termed “an elegant selection”. The product variants, their finish, quality, content and style harmonized well with the best of European fashion collections thus embodying a great selection for the fashion conscious male both in Sri Lanka and overseas.

 

Following the success of the ‘FH Studio Collection’ at the ‘Colombo Fashion Week’, Jaroslav Krcmar and Tomas Zobina from JTC Investments Pvt. Ltd. in the Czech Republic had spoken to Fouzul Hameed and explored possibilities of marketing the ‘FH’ brand in Prague. Successful discussions between the two parties will now see Sri Lanka’s ‘FH Studio Collection’ soon available in the Czech capital Prague, thus taking the very best of local couture to this European capital.

 

Since 1992, the extensive historic centre of Prague has been included in the UNESCO list of World Heritage Sites, making the city one of the most popular tourist destinations in Europe, receiving more than 4.1 million international visitors annually, as of 2009.

 

Said Fouzul Hameed, “This was my third year at the Colombo Fashion Week. In retrospect I feel that this has also been my best collection compared to the previous two years. The FH Brand is currently marketed in India and Maldives. Adding the Czech Republicto this growing portfolio is indeed a significant achievement. Not only does it bring me a sense of personal pride and achievement, it has also brought glory and honour to Sri Lanka. This will undoubtedly help me and other local designers to compete and unveil unique collections on par with international designers … and does augur well for Sri Lankan couture”.
